From: Thomas Gleixner Date: Mon, 13 Sep 2021 15:39:41 +0000 (+0200) Subject: Documentation/process: Add maintainer handbooks section X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=604370e106cc;p=linux.git Documentation/process: Add maintainer handbooks section General rules for patch submission, coding style and related details are available, but most subsystems have their subsystem-specific extra rules which differ or go beyond the common rules. Mark suggested to add a subsystem/maintainer handbook section, where subsystem maintainers can explain their specific quirks. Add the section and link to it from the submitting-patches document. [ bp: Add a SPDX identifier. ] Suggested-by: Mark Brown Signed-off-by: Thomas Gleixner Signed-off-by: Borislav Petkov Link: https://lkml.kernel.org/r/20181107171149.074948887@linutronix.de Link: https://lore.kernel.org/r/20210913153942.15251-2-bp@alien8.de Signed-off-by: Jonathan Corbet --- diff --git a/Documentation/process/index.rst b/Documentation/process/index.rst index dd231ffc8422d..9f1b88492bb33 100644 --- a/Documentation/process/index.rst +++ b/Documentation/process/index.rst @@ -27,6 +27,7 @@ Below are the essential guides that every developer should read. submitting-patches programming-language coding-style + maintainer-handbooks maintainer-pgp-guide email-clients kernel-enforcement-statement diff --git a/Documentation/process/maintainer-handbooks.rst b/Documentation/process/maintainer-handbooks.rst new file mode 100644 index 0000000000000..cd707727dc8fb --- /dev/null +++ b/Documentation/process/maintainer-handbooks.rst @@ -0,0 +1,16 @@ +.. SPDX-License-Identifier: GPL-2.0 + +.. _maintainer_handbooks_main: + +Subsystem and maintainer tree specific development process notes +================================================================ + +The purpose of this document is to provide subsystem specific information +which is supplementary to the general development process handbook +:ref:`Documentation/process `. + +Contents: + +.. toctree:: + :numbered: + :maxdepth: 2 diff --git a/Documentation/process/submitting-patches.rst b/Documentation/process/submitting-patches.rst index 8ad6b93f91e6d..f5ae1efd8cb65 100644 --- a/Documentation/process/submitting-patches.rst +++ b/Documentation/process/submitting-patches.rst @@ -21,6 +21,10 @@ If you're unfamiliar with ``git``, you would be well-advised to learn how to use it, it will make your life as a kernel developer and in general much easier. +Some subsystems and maintainer trees have additional information about +their workflow and expectations, see :ref:`Documentation/process/maintainer +handbooks `. + Obtain a current source tree ----------------------------